Introduction to Quantum Computing

Dhairyya Agarwal, Shalini D and Srinjoy Ganguly

Chapter Chapter 1 in Productizing Quantum Computing, 2023, pp 1-21 from Springer

Abstract: Abstract Quantum computing is a rapidly growing field that works on the principle of quantum mechanics. In this chapter, we will discuss the prominent quantum mechanics concept with a bit of mathematical info and show how different fields came together to form a new field called quantum. We’ll discuss some prominent gates and how to make a simple entangled state with a pictorial representation. Going through every concept of this chapter will prepare you to proceed to other concepts in later chapters.
